How To Keep Your Car Fuel-efficient

Due to the continuous increase on the prices of oil products used by most car models, more and more car buyers are focusing their attention on cars with impressive fuel economy features. As a result, a lot of individual who are trying to find cars for sale are doing their best to purchase a vehicle with this particular characteristic. This is because having a fuel-efficient car could allow them to earn extra savings most especially when they are currently handling bad credit auto finance that requires relatively higher payments.
In case you currently own a fuel-efficient car, you are quite lucky. However, there is also a great need for you to maintain its excellent fuel economy. In order to do this, you can conduct an extensive car research about the proper things that must be done or simply try the following procedures.

1. Drive your car efficiently

One of the most effective ways to maintain your car’s impressive fuel-efficient features is to ...
... practice the proper driving techniques. One of this is by avoiding over speeding. This technique is very important since a car consumes more gas when it runs at a speed of more than 60 miles per hour.

In addition to this, you also need to avoid making quick starts since this forces the car’s engine to burn more fuel. Avoiding sudden stops and keeping the vehicle’s speed in a steady pace also contributes to lesser fuel consumption.

2. Perform the needed car maintenance

Apart from practicing efficient driving, you can also keep the car’s good fuel consumption by performing the needed maintenance. One of the most effective maintenance is by keeping the vehicle’s engine tuned. Regular tune-up prevents the engine from getting damaged and force it consume more fuel. Keeping the car’s tire pressure at its recommended rate also keeps the vehicle’s fuel intake at its minimal level.

3. Try using some gas-saving devices in the market

You can also try using some of the gas-saving devices sold in the market. However, you need to make sure that the devices you will be using are reliable since this might ruin the car’s fuel efficiency instead of improving it.
